TPWallet 架构详解与未来展望

一、TPWallet总体架构概述

TPWallet(Token/Transaction Wallet)可理解为一个模块化、多层次的客户端系统,典型分层包括:

1) 表现层(UI/UX):多平台适配(移动、桌面、Web3插件),本地化与无障碍设计。可插拔主题与多语言资源。

2) 核心钱包层:账户管理、助记词/私钥派生(BIP32/39/44等)、多账户和多链支持、交易构建与签名模块。

3) 密钥管理与安全层:软件KDF、硬件钱包集成、MPC(多方计算)、TEE/安全元件、阈值签名与多签策略。

4) 网络与节点层:轻节点/远程节点(RPC)选择、链状态同步、链上/链下数据缓存、跨链桥接适配器。

5) 服务与策略层:费用估算与优化、交易池管理、重放与回滚处理、合规审计与隐私策略。

6) 扩展与SDK:插件系统、dApp桥接、第三方服务集成(KYC、反欺诈、市场数据)。

二、安全检查建议(工程与流程)

1) 密钥生命周期管理:引入硬件、安全元件和MPC,避免私钥明文持久化。助记词使用安全显示与一次性缓存。定期提示用户备份与恢复演练。

2) 交易前保护:交易预览、智能规则引擎(检测高额度/异常地址)、DApp权限沙箱、签名白名单与撤销机制。

3) 运行时防护:内存加密、反调试、完整性校验、自动漏洞上报、行为分析与沙箱测试。

4) CI/CD安全:静态/动态代码扫描、依赖库签名、第三方合约安全审计和模糊测试。

5) 监控与应急:链上资金流水异常报警、热钱包冷钱包分离、快速冻结与多方共识的应急流程。

三、全球化与智能技术融合

1) 本地化与法规适配:自动识别地区法规并提示合规要求(例如KYC弹性策略),支持多语言与货币显示。税务报表模板可选。

2) 智能路由与费率优化:利用机器学习预测链拥堵、自动选择Layer2/侧链或合并打包以最优费用与速度完成交易。

3) 风险与反欺诈智能:基于模型的地址信誉评分、行为指纹、设备指纹与链上图谱分析,实时阻断高风险操作。

4) 个性化产品:AI驱动的资产组合建议、定期再平衡提醒、自动化流动性提供器(LP)建议。

四、市场未来前景预测

1) 市场格局:钱包将从单纯密钥工具转为金融平台,集成交易、借贷、支付、合规及数据服务。企业级钱包和零售钱包分化明显。

2) 收益模式:交易手续费分成、白标与SDK授权、数据增值服务、合规与托管收费。

3) 竞争与机会:跨链互操作性与用户体验是决定性因素。隐私保护与合规双刃剑将重塑信任基础。

五、新兴技术对支付的影响

1) Layer2与Rollup:zk-Rollup/Optimistic Rollup带来更低费率与更高吞吐,钱包需内置路由与回退机制。

2) 状态通道与闪电网络:适合高频小额支付,钱包需支持通道管理与渠道流动性。

3) 隐私技术:zk-SNARK/zk-STARK与混合隐私方案提升可用性但带来合规挑战。

4) MPC与阈签支付:提供不牺牲UX的多方安全签名,利于企业托管与社交恢复方案。

六、出块速度与交易速度影响分析

1) 链层决定性:出块速度(block time)直接影响交易确认延迟。高出块频率有利于低延迟,但增加链分叉概率。

2) 钱包优化点:签名并行化、交易打包(batching)、使用Layer2或侧链、交易替换(Replace-By-Fee)与本地乐观确认(optimistic UX)可显著改善用户感知速度。

3) 延迟瓶颈:网络延迟、RPC节点负载、签名硬件延迟均为实际体验关键。离线签名与异步提交策略能平衡安全与速度。

七、实施建议与路线图

1) 分阶段实现:先构建安全核心(密钥管理+基本交易),随后引入多签、MPC与硬件集成,再叠加智能路由和ML模型。

2) 开放生态:提供清晰SDK与插件接口,鼓励第三方构建支付通道、合规模块与数据服务。

3) 持续审计与透明度:定期公开安全审计报告、关键库签名与赏金计划,建立用户信任。

结论:TPWallet的竞争力将由安全能力、跨链与Layer2接入、智能化运营与全球合规能力共同决定。出块速度是底层链的属性,但通过Layer2、路由与钱包端优化可显著提升交易速度与支付体验。面向未来,MPC、zk技术与智能风控将成为钱包演进的关键。

作者:程墨(Cheng Mo)发布时间:2025-09-07 12:31:27

评论

SkyWalker

对出块速度和钱包优化部分解释清晰,尤其认可用Layer2来改善用户体验的思路。

林晓雨

文章对安全检查给了很实际的建议,尤其是MPC与硬件结合的设计思路,企业实现路径很有帮助。

CryptoNeko

智能路由和费用预测那段很有意思,能否再补充一下模型训练用的数据来源?

周明

关于合规与隐私的平衡讨论很到位,希望后续能看到更多可操作的KYC弹性策略示例。

Ada王

整体架构清晰,尤其喜欢分阶段实现建议,有助于产品落地与风险控制。

相关阅读